在信息化时代,数据库已经成为各类企业和组织存储、管理和分析数据的核心工具。而SQL(Structured Query Language,结构化查询语言)作为数据库查询与操作的标准语言,其重要性不言而喻。今天,我们就来探讨一下《SQL代码魔法:数据库查询与操作的艺术》这本书,深入了解SQL的奥秘,掌握数据库查询与操作的艺术。

一、SQL入门篇

《SQL代码魔法:数据库查询与操作的艺术》从SQL的基础知识入手,详细介绍了SQL语言的基本语法、数据类型、函数和运算符等。对于初学者来说,这部分内容是理解后续章节的基础。

SQL基础语法

SQL基础语法主要包括数据定义语言(DDL)、数据操纵语言(DML)、数据控制语言(DCL)和数据查询语言(DQL)。其中,DDL用于创建、修改和删除数据库对象;DML用于插入、更新和删除数据;DCL用于授予和回收数据库访问权限;DQL用于查询数据。

数据类型与运算符

SQL支持多种数据类型,如整数、浮点数、字符、日期等。同时,SQL www.kslsytzl.com还提供了丰富的运算符,包括算术运算符、比较运算符、逻辑运算符等,用于对数据进行处理。

打开网易新闻 查看精彩图片

二、SQL进阶篇

在掌握了SQL基础语法后,我们还需要深入学习SQL的高级功能,以便更好地应对复杂的数据库操作。

联合查询与子查询

联合查询(UNION)用于将多个SELECT语句的结果集合并为一个结果集。子查询(Subquery)则是在SELECT语句中嵌套另一个SELECT语句,用于获取更复杂的数据。

数据库连接与视图

数据库连接(JOIN)用于将两个或多个表中的数据根据一定的条件关联起来。视图(View)则是一个虚拟表,它可以从一个或多个表中查询数据,并对外提供统一的视图。

索引与性能优化

索引是提高数据库查询性能的关键因素。合理地创建和使用索引,可以大大加快查询速度。此外,性能优化还包括查询语句优化、数据库设计优化等方面。

三、SQL实践篇子查询(Subquery)则是在SELECT语句中嵌套另一个SELECT m.kslsytzl.com语句

《SQL代码魔法:数据库查询与操作的艺术》不仅介绍了SQL的理论知识,还提供了大量的实践案例,帮助读者将所学知识应用到实际工作中。

实践案例

书中提供了多个实践案例,包括企业级应用、电商系统、在线教育平台等。通过这些案例,读者可以了解SQL在实际项目中的应用,并掌握解决实际问题的方法。

实践项目

为了使读者更好地掌握SQL技能,书中还提供了一些实践项目,如创建一个简单的博客系统、设计一个在线商城数据库等。读者可以根据自己的需求,选择合适的项目进行实践。

打开网易新闻 查看精彩图片

四、总结

《SQL代码魔法:数据库查询与操作的艺术》是一本非常适合数据库初学者和进阶者的书籍。它从SQL的基础知识讲起,逐步深入到高级功能,并通过丰富的实践案例和项目,帮助读者掌握数据库查询与操作的艺术。SQL(Structured Query kslsytzl.com,结构化查询语言)

在阅读本书的过程中,读者可以:

掌握SQL语言的基本语法和常用函数;

熟悉数据库的创建、修改和删除操作;

学会使用联合查询、子查询、数据库连接和视图等高级功能;

了解索引和性能优化技巧;

通过实践案例和项目,提高SQL应用能力。

总之,《SQL代码魔法:数据库查询与操作的艺术》是一本值得推荐的数据库学习资料。无论你是数据库新手还是有一定基础的读者,都能从中获得宝贵的知识和经验。让我们一起走进SQL的魔法世界,探索数据库查询与操作的艺术吧!

打开网易新闻 查看精彩图片